Wireshark网络抓包工具深度解析
需积分: 33 53 浏览量
更新于2024-08-16
收藏 1.2MB PPT 举报
"Wireshark是一款强大的网络抓包和分析工具,适用于多种操作系统,如Windows、MacOSX、Linux等。它能够实时捕获网络流量,并对数据包进行深入分析。Wireshark的前身是Ethereal,由Gerald Combs于1998年创建,经过多个开发者和社区成员的贡献,逐渐发展成为现在广受欢迎的开源软件,遵循GPL授权。2006年,项目更名为Wireshark,其官方网站为http://www.wireshark.org/。
Wireshark的主界面直观,提供了丰富的功能。用户可以通过Capture菜单选择要捕获的网络接口,点击“Start”开始抓包,或使用工具栏快捷按钮。此外,Wireshark还支持设置抓包选项,如指定特定的网络接口、过滤条件等。
Wireshark的抓包功能包括:
1. **抓包与停止抓包**:用户可以随时开始或停止捕获网络流量,以便分析特定时间段的数据。
2. **保存抓包文件**:捕获的数据可以保存为`.pcap`或`.pcapng`格式的文件,方便后续分析或共享。
3. **设置抓包选项**:允许用户自定义捕获参数,如只捕获特定协议、指定IP地址等。
4. **捕捉过滤器**:在捕获过程中应用过滤器,减少不必要的数据包,提高分析效率。
5. **显示过滤器**:在分析时使用显示过滤器,快速定位和筛选出需要关注的数据包。
6. **Follow TCP Stream**:此功能用于查看特定TCP连接的完整数据流,便于理解交互过程。
7. **实际应用案例**:Wireshark广泛应用于网络故障排查、协议分析、安全审计等多个场景,例如检测网络延迟问题、分析应用层通信、查找网络安全漏洞等。
Wireshark的强大之处在于其支持众多网络协议的解析,包括TCP/IP、HTTP、FTP、SMTP、DNS等,以及各种加密协议如SSL/TLS。通过其强大的显示和过滤功能,用户可以深入理解网络通信的细节,对于网络管理员、开发人员和安全专家来说,是不可或缺的工具。"
以上是对Wireshark工具及其主要功能的详细介绍,涵盖了从基本的抓包操作到高级分析功能,旨在提供全面的理解和使用指导。
2022-08-08 上传
点击了解资源详情
2024-10-12 上传
速本
- 粉丝: 20
- 资源: 2万+
最新资源
- WPF渲染层字符绘制原理探究及源代码解析
- 海康精简版监控软件:iVMS4200Lite版发布
- 自动化脚本在lspci-TV的应用介绍
- Chrome 81版本稳定版及匹配的chromedriver下载
- 深入解析Python推荐引擎与自然语言处理
- MATLAB数学建模算法程序包及案例数据
- Springboot人力资源管理系统:设计与功能
- STM32F4系列微控制器开发全面参考指南
- Python实现人脸识别的机器学习流程
- 基于STM32F103C8T6的HLW8032电量采集与解析方案
- Node.js高效MySQL驱动程序:mysqljs/mysql特性和配置
- 基于Python和大数据技术的电影推荐系统设计与实现
- 为ripro主题添加Live2D看板娘的后端资源教程
- 2022版PowerToys Everything插件升级,稳定运行无报错
- Map简易斗地主游戏实现方法介绍
- SJTU ICS Lab6 实验报告解析